IndyCar driver James Hinchcliffe joined the ranks of those who have peed in their car mid-race during Sunday's Honda Indy Grand Prix of Alabama.
Hinchcliffe recounted the ordeal to NBCSN after rainy conditions forced the race to go under a red flag.
"You're talking to a guy who just wet himself," Hinchcliffe declared.
He mentioned that Carlos Munoz had a similar experience a few years ago, though it doesn't sound like Munoz wanted the world to know that.
